黑狐家游戏

vb与sql数据库连接代码,深入浅出,使用Visual Basic连接SQL数据库实例的实战指南

欧气 1 0

本文目录导读:

vb与sql数据库连接代码,深入浅出,使用Visual Basic连接SQL数据库实例的实战指南

图片来源于网络,如有侵权联系删除

  1. VB连接SQL数据库实例的原理
  2. VB连接SQL数据库实例的实例代码

随着信息技术的飞速发展,数据库在各个领域都扮演着至关重要的角色,在Visual Basic(VB)编程中,连接数据库是实现数据操作的基础,本文将详细介绍如何使用VB连接SQL数据库实例,并通过实例代码演示连接过程,旨在帮助读者轻松掌握这一技能。

VB连接SQL数据库实例的原理

在VB中,连接SQL数据库实例主要依赖于ADO(ActiveX Data Objects)技术,ADO是微软推出的一种数据访问技术,它为开发者提供了一套统一的接口,可以方便地连接各种数据库,包括SQL Server、Oracle、MySQL等。

要连接SQL数据库实例,我们需要执行以下步骤:

1、引入ADO命名空间;

vb与sql数据库连接代码,深入浅出,使用Visual Basic连接SQL数据库实例的实战指南

图片来源于网络,如有侵权联系删除

2、创建连接对象;

3、设置连接字符串;

4、打开连接;

5、执行数据库操作;

vb与sql数据库连接代码,深入浅出,使用Visual Basic连接SQL数据库实例的实战指南

图片来源于网络,如有侵权联系删除

6、关闭连接。

VB连接SQL数据库实例的实例代码

以下是一个使用VB连接SQL数据库实例的实例代码,演示了如何连接到本地SQL Server实例,并查询“Students”表中的数据。

Imports System.Data
Imports System.Data.SqlClient
Module Module1
    Sub Main()
        ' 创建连接对象
        Dim conn As New SqlConnection()
        ' 设置连接字符串
        conn.ConnectionString = "Server=.;Database=TestDB;Integrated Security=True;"
        Try
            ' 打开连接
            conn.Open()
            ' 创建命令对象
            Dim cmd As New SqlCommand()
            cmd.Connection = conn
            cmd.CommandText = "SELECT * FROM Students"
            cmd.CommandType = CommandType.Text
            ' 执行查询
            Dim reader As SqlDataReader = cmd.ExecuteReader()
            ' 遍历查询结果
            While reader.Read()
                Console.WriteLine(reader("StudentID") & " " & reader("StudentName"))
            End While
            ' 关闭查询结果
            reader.Close()
        Catch ex As Exception
            Console.WriteLine("Error: " & ex.Message)
        Finally
            ' 关闭连接
            If conn.State = ConnectionState.Open Then
                conn.Close()
            End If
        End Try
        Console.WriteLine("Press any key to exit...")
        Console.ReadKey()
    End Sub
End Module

本文详细介绍了使用VB连接SQL数据库实例的方法,并通过实例代码展示了连接过程,读者可以根据实际需求,修改连接字符串中的数据库实例、数据库名称、用户名和密码等信息,通过学习本文,相信读者已经掌握了VB连接SQL数据库实例的技巧,为今后的编程实践打下了坚实基础。

标签: #vb连接sql数据库实例

黑狐家游戏
  • 评论列表

留言评论